Provide daily care, supervision, and guidance to all female children in the home.
Ensure a safe, nurturing, and supportive environment that promotes trust and respect.
Monitor children's health, hygiene, nutrition, and emotional needs.
Assist with children's daily routines such as waking up, meals, school preparation, homework, and bedtime.
Foster positive behaviors, discipline, and conflict resolution among children.
Support children's education by liaising with teachers, helping with homework, and motivating academic progress.
Organize recreational, cultural, and skill-building activities for holistic development.
Maintain records of attendance, health check-ups, and progress reports as required.
Ensure compliance with organizational child protection and safeguarding policies.
. Reports any incidents, concerns, or needs to the Superintendent & Child Welfare Officer
